🏠 Buyer Tips

Prioritize properties with direct water access or unobstructed views for maximum long-term value. Inspect flood insurance requirements and easement restrictions common to waterfront homes. Consider seasonal water level fluctuations and maintenance responsibilities. Work with agents experienced in La Mesa waterfront transactions understanding local regulations. Verify property boundaries, dock rights, and water recreation privileges. Schedule inspections during various weather conditions to assess drainage and structural integrity near water features.

About La Mesa

La Mesa spans 9.4 square miles of picturesque East County terrain featuring excellent schools, shopping, and dining. The community balances suburban tranquility with convenient freeway access to downtown San Diego. Parks, hiking trails, and recreational facilities support active lifestyles. Historic downtown La Mesa offers charming restaurants, boutiques, and community events. Nearby Grossmont Center provides comprehensive shopping. The region's Mediterranean climate ensures year-round outdoor enjoyment and water-based recreation.

What maintenance is required for La Mesa waterfront properties? +
Waterfront homes require inspections of drainage systems, foundation stability, and erosion control. Dock and water access areas need regular maintenance. Landscaping demands may be higher due to water feature proximity. Professional inspections identify potential water-damage issues. Budget for specialized maintenance associated with waterfront property ownership.
